fabricjs

    0熱度

    1回答

    我試圖用fabricjs畫semecircle(部門): $('#button').click(function(){ fov+=10; drawSector(fov); }); $('#button2').click(function(){ fov-=10; drawSector(fov); }); var w=500,h=500; va

    -1熱度

    1回答

    我想通過鍵盤移動所選對象,因爲它可以更準確地移動,我不知道該怎麼做。

    0熱度

    1回答

    我需要關於如何解決此問題的建議。 我們正在開發一個使用fabricjs的圖像編輯應用程序。我們還開發了在圖像上應用濾鏡的功能,如here(along with the code)。 它們在1100像素×700像素的圖像上工作得非常好,但如果圖像尺寸超過此值,濾鏡在圖像上應用之前需要花費時間。我能做些什麼來使大圖像的濾鏡應用程序更快?

    0熱度

    2回答

    fabric.Canvas.prototype.getItemsByName = function(name) { var objectList = [], objects = this.getObjects(); for (var i = 0, len = this.size(); i < len; i++) { if (objects[i].name

    0熱度

    2回答

    我有一個數據集,其中包含一個HTML5畫布的圖層數組。我使用fabric.js來管理畫布的所有元素。應該按順序加載圖層,形成不同的場景。我通過forEach循環遍歷數據集。 (編輯 - 進一步研究後,我看到for和for循環都是同步的)。 問題是,一旦代碼到達加載圖像的位置,異步行爲就會啓動並且進程跳轉到下一個循環以開始處理下一個圖層。正如你可以想象的那樣,這會導致圖層在畫布上出現亂序並最終失真的

    0熱度

    1回答

    我想讓用戶通過選擇一個輸入字段的偏移量,來自另一個輸入字段的模糊和來自colorpicker的顏色來設置文本陰影。我使用的角度和fabric.js,這是我的HTML: <div class="shadow"> <div class="slider-input"> <span>Offset</span> <input min="-25" max="25" step=

    0熱度

    1回答

    我在fabricjs畫布上有一個矩形對象。現在,當我嘗試縮放矩形時,它總是從固定角度縮放,並且只擴展到鼠標所在的方向。我想要的是,當我縮放它應該從中心擴展和擴大任何一方。我試着設置originX和originY,但那不起作用。誰可以幫我這個事?謝謝! var rect = new fabric.Rect({ top: 150, left: 150, width: 100, height:

    -2熱度

    2回答

    我想了解Fabric.js的JavaScript庫的功能,但無法弄清楚這2行,因爲它們看起來不像函數,也不是條件式的,所以這裏的目的是什麼? 1行: ​​ 第2行: ctx[methodName + 'Rect'](left, top, size, size); 全功能: _drawControl: function(control, ctx, methodName, left, top) {

    0熱度

    2回答

    我正在嘗試創建一個畫布,其中用戶可以在其上使用add background image或background color and write a text。但是,當背景圖像存在時,我無法顯示背景顏色。我創建了一個小提琴來展示一個例子。您可以嘗試添加圖像並在小提琴中添加顏色按鈕。 http://jsbin.com/sukuvoqahi/edit?html,js,output 這裏是我的代碼 cons

    2熱度

    1回答

    目前我正在使用pdfjs。我已經添加了fabric.js來對pdf文件進行註釋。 以Json格式保存在.json文件中的註釋。以前它來自AWS Dynamo DB,但由於現在大量數據我們想要在AWS S3 bucket上移動。我已將AWS庫集成到Codeigniter中。 現在如何從S3直接在fabric.js框架中加載json文件?